When we get an odd number (1,3,5,7,9.) of negative factors the opposite is true and we will get a negative product. Therefore an even (2,4,6,8,10.) number of negative factors produces a positive product. Recall that when multiplying with negative numbers, each pair of negatives yields a positive product. The reason here is that our exponent (3) is odd. If we work through the example above, we see that we get the same answer whether or not we use parentheses around the base. Since the negative is wrapped inside of the parentheses, both are now part of the base. Now let’s think about the other scenario. In this case, we would raise 2 to the 2nd power first, and then multiply the result by -1. From the order of operations, we know that we must perform exponent operations before we multiply. We can really think about: -2 2 as -1 x 2 2. It won’t give us a different answer in every scenario, but it’s important to know what’s causing a different answer. We can see from the above example that parentheses around a negative base do make a difference. If we are working with a negative number raised to a power, the base does not include the negative part unless we use parentheses: When we work with exponents, we need to be extra cautious when dealing with negative numbers.
